Day Named To Nature Walk, Healthy Lifestyle And Introspection

Chandigarh, December 29, 2018: The fifth day of the NSS seven days camp was dedicated to Swasth Bharat. The NSS volunteers were taken for a nature walk along with their Programme Officers Dr Anupam Bahri, Ikreet Singh, Manjushri Sharma, Purva Mishra and Gaurav Gaur.
This nature walk started from Panjab University campus to lake at village Dhanas and later-on the students entered to the Botanical Garden at Village Sarangpur. The students were made to understand the importance of flora and fauna around them. This main motive behind this walk was to make the students to understand the importance of physical activities like walking, running etc for keeping themselves fit. In the botanical garden the students were made to see the magnificent work done by the Department of Environment, Chandigarh Administration.
The NSS volunteers roamed around and saw the solar panels, wind mills, plants nursery and a water pond made for the migratory birds. There were different kinds of lotus ponds also available in the Botanical Garden at Sarganpur. The students took a round of the garden and enjoyed the different varieties of blooming flowers. They were provided with healthy nutritional refreshments in the form of bananas. Afterwards the students shared their experiences of this visit and one of them said " I was not aware of such a beautiful park in the vicinity of Chandigarh before". Another student said "sometimes... it is difficult to make our home and surroundings clean and green but Chandigarh Botanical garden is a perfect example of cleanliness, greenery and innovation". One can feel the clam and quietness and do introspection at such a lovely place. All the students were of the opinion that in the modern times, when we are becoming the slaves of the technology, we are going away from the mother nature and hence we can’t feel the internal happiness and affection, but this visit was organized to take them a step closer to nature. The day ended with a delicious lunch at Panjab University campus only.
